this place is a 'you order and seat yourself with a number' kind of place. we went on a weekday around 930-10 so it was not busy at all. we sat outside in the parklet seating and it was pleasant on a sunny day. they have a few stool and table indoor sitting and also patio seating as well. i'm so glad this establishment is doing well bc the past few places did not fare so well at this same spot. we were craving pancakes but didn't want a large breakfast so we got the kids menu item that came with scrambled eggs, bacon or sausage and a side of fruit. we liked that the kids scrambled eggs were soft scrambles! i do not enjoy over cooked eggs so this was a nice touch. the pancakes.. oh man. they are so yummy! perfect fluff and the blackberries were exceptionally fresh. loved the cinnamon mascarpone on the pancakes which goes well with the maple syrup. when we are hungry, we would love to try more of their offerings but i'm so glad we finally tried this place! they tend to get real busy during the weekend so stop in early to avoid the crowds.

Arrived on a Saturday afternoon, with a line out the door. The way it works is by waiting to place an order and the server will seat you. However, depending on if the place is busy which it was for Saturday brunch--we waited about 30-40 minutes to place an order. Then, it took about another 10-15 minutes for our food to come out after ordering. The food was worth the wait though! *Short Rib Benedict: 4/5 pretty tasty with the large chunks of short rib and with the mild sweetness from the sweet potato latkes - however personally, still lacked some type of flavor but was able to fix it with the help of Cholula*Crispy Potatoes: 6/5 w/ the spicy aioli - hands down favorite part of Zuzu's. couldn't help but scarf it down, wishing we had more*Agua Fresca: 5/5 - sweet, slightly tart, refreshing. not watered down*Sweet potato pancakes: 5/5 we were extremely full after sharing the potatoes and benedict but that didn't stop us from enjoying the pancakes. It's definitely a filling dish on its own, but the pomegranates were a nice touch to keep it from being too heavy. Really loved the peanut/almond?? butter on topWould come back again for the crispy potatoes alone!!
